Your friend Andrew has heard that you are studying Canadian income taxation. He has heard people
discussing something called the '21-Year Rule' with regard to trusts. He has come to you with
questions regarding this rule, since his father recently established inter vivos trusts for both Andrew and his mother.
Required:
Briefly answer the following questions:
With regard to non-spousal trusts:
A)What is the purpose of the 21-Year Rule?
B)What event occurs on the 21st anniversary of a trust?
C)What types of properties are subject to the 21-Year Rule?
D)How can the consequences of the 21-Year Rule be avoided?
With regard to spousal trusts:
E)What is the exception to the 21-Year Rule for spousal trusts?
